I had long meant to support -fast-math on Solaris 2/x86. While working
on the Solaris toplevel libgcc move, I've done it with the following
patch.
The only complication is that I need to make sure that SSE insns are only
used if the host supports them.
Bootstrapped without regressions on i386-pc-solaris2.8,
i386-pc-solaris2.9, i386-pc-solaris2.11, and sparc-sun-solaris2.11.
The libgcc part depends on the toplevel libgcc patch, so actually
applying this patch will have to wait until that one is in.
Ok for mainline?

The comment referencing stmxcsr doesn't match the movss code.
It's still a 4 byte opcode, so the code still works.
I do wonder if using "movaps %xmm0,%xmm0" might be cleaner,
to avoid clobbering a register, even if that register is
surely dead anyway. That's a 3 byte opcode though, so the
handler would need updating.

Copy-and-paste error ;-( We already have the same code in
libgfortran/config/fpu-387.h and (without the comment) in
gcc/testsuite/lib/target-supports.exp. I still mean to fix
driver-i386.c to correcly handle -march=native on Solaris 8 and 9 which
cannot in general execute SSE insns. I wonder if there's a better place
to share this code?
